What Does a Health MLM IBO Do?
As an IBO, your job is to sell products and build a team. You can make money in two ways:
- Selling Products – You earn a cut for each product you sell to buyers.
- Recruiting a Team – If you recruit others, you can make commissions when they make sales.

Challenges of Being a Health MLM IBO
Upfront Expenses
Most MLMs need you to buy a starter kit, which can cost $100 to $1,000. You may also have to meet sales quotas.Focus on Signing People Up
While selling products can earn you money, MLMs often rely a lot on building a team. This can feel uncomfortable for some people.Low Earnings
Many MLMs publish that only a few people earn big money. Most IBOs make little compared to their time.Too Many Sellers
With lots of people selling the same items, it can be hard to find customers.Criticism
MLMs often get bad press, and health MLMs in particular are criticized for false promises.
